Here are the three techniques you can use today to start creating quality content for your followers. One other great thing about these techniques is that they not only great techniques for creating quality content for you followers, but it also helps create a following.

  1. Create Quality Content

When you share information that patients care about, they will be more likely to comment or share your post with their entire network of followers. Ex: Blog about the benefits of Invisalign or tweeting about specials

  1. Listen

Take the time to read and respond to comments in a heartfelt but professional way. By listening to patients, you show them that you care about them, and it helps them feel more confident about working with you. The more confident someone feels about the service they receive, the more likely they will refer that service to their friends and family.

  1. Be consistent and frequent

82% of marketers who blog daily acquired a customer using their blog, as opposed to 57% of marketers who blog monthly –which, by itself is still an impressive result. However, from these statistics you can see that the frequency changes the likelihood of acquiring new customers dramatically.
